Output dd4c1a0b95e9407f2c3159e76e2a9e661299fa2d8328d66af2d100a9f850a64a:0

value
666773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c81290e3d18a9e33831a27832b0457e76dc1750 OP_EQUAL
address
3EVwFcvFF6WhMHRWE2XNvesUFBVPShMFNm
transaction
dd4c1a0b95e9407f2c3159e76e2a9e661299fa2d8328d66af2d100a9f850a64a